James Brown estate battle rages on Feb 11, 2007
A judge in Aiken, S.C., still has not ruled on whether the court will appoint a special administrator to oversee the late singer James Brown's estate. Aiken County Judge Jack Early said that he will make a ruling on the case next week, the Aiken Standard reported Saturday. (Washington Times, DC)

GARY A showdown almost was assured three weeks ago when Rudy Clay replaced Scott L. King as mayor, but King kept his job as special administrator in charge of the Gary Sanitary District ... King, who still is the court-appointed special administrator of the sanitary district, rehired Peller on Wednesday ... After decades of financial turmoil, environmental problems and mismanagement, the GSD in 1987 was put under control of a special administrator, a job held by the elected mayor ever since. Judge terminates water department post held by Kilpatrick, calls for creation of regional authority Jan 7, 2006
A mayor of Detroit has served as court-appointed special administrator for nearly three decades, with Feikens in charge of a 1977 lawsuit filed by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ency charging that the water department was polluting the Detroit River through its waste-treatment plant. Feikens gave his court virtual receivership authority to bring the Detroit water system into compliance with federal anti-pollution laws but appointed then-Mayor Coleman Young as special administrator to carry...
